This report presents estimates that, for each state, measure the need for the Food Stamp Program (FSP) and the program’s effectiveness in each of the three years from 2003 to 2005. The estimated numbers of people eligible for the FSP measure the need for the program. The estimated FSP participation rates measure, state by state, the program’s performance in reaching its target population. In addition to the participation rates that pertain to all eligible people, we derived estimates of participation rates for the “working poor,” that is, people who were eligible for the FSP and lived in households in which someone earned income from a job.
